  King - 2.5" Prerunner Series Shocks w/Reservoir
King Shock 2 ½" diameter shock is the most widely used shock for just about all applications.
Specs:
· Billet 6061 T-6 machined aluminum parts
· Fully threaded seamless steel cylinder O.D. for coil overs
· Large 7/8" diameter shaft - hard chrome plated for strength
· honed and polished bores
· 5/8" teflon lined spherical bearings
· Aeroquip -10 high temperature blue hose (Braided on request)
· external reservoir for easy mounting
· Heat treated stainless steel alloy valving designed for extreme temperatures
· Self adjusting valving/washer system on piston
· Custom valved for each specific application
· Completely rebuildable and revalvable
King Shock 2 ½" shocks ran the Australian safari and performed flawlessly for 13 days and 7,000 off-road racing miles.
